“Unlikely Saint”

The final chapter of this five-issue DC series closes with a cover that's impossible to look away from — a suited figure with skeletal hands crossed and gold coins covering his eyes stares outward against a blood-splattered backdrop, framed by angels and stars in rich purples and golds. Tony Harris's painted cover work gives the whole thing a genuinely unsettling, almost devotional quality that suits the story title "Unlikely Saint" perfectly. A worthy send-off to a series that clearly had a lot on its mind about death, redemption, and the space in between.
